Opening of “Tack Room For Becky’s Gift” Exceeds Expectations

Business moved to space in Hub

By Linda Barnes

Tack Room For Becky’s Gift had a very successful opening week last month, with many first-time and previous customers visiting our new home in the Andover Community Hub at 157 Main Street. With spring riding lessons and horse summer camps just around the corner, we delighted in outfitting the wee rider crowd, as well as helping established horse folk find treasures they shouldn’t be without!

We anticipated there would be some adjustment challenges to working in a new space, but the transition to the Hub has been seamless. Most of our customers had never had the opportunity to visit the Hub and absolutely loved the history of the building, as well as the rustic nature of the tack shop. 

Our greatest challenge was me trying to navigate how to use our new Square Reader for credit card sales. Thank you to the many customers who helped me figure it out!

Thanks also to Kearsarge area artists Keri Bresaw (painting) and Janice Lalmond Hagan (beaded jewelry) for their donations of two amazing raffle prizes to celebrate Tack Room’s opening. The drawing will be held on Saturday, May 1, with proceeds going to Becky’s Gift Equine Relief for the purpose of assisting horse owners in need.
